"The Dancing Dragon" by Marcia Vaughan tells the enchanting story of a young girl who dreams of becoming a dancer. When a vibrant, playful dragon appears in her village, it inspires her to pursue her passion. The dragon encourages her to embrace her uniqueness and teaches her the joy of movement and expression. As the girl learns to dance, she discovers the importance of believing in herself and sharing her talent with others. Together, they celebrate creativity and friendship, showcasing the beauty of following one's dreams and the magic that can happen when you let your spirit soar.
